FIFTY-NINE STUDENT-ATHLETES SCHEDULED TO DOUBLE BACK FOR NCAA XC CHAMPIONSHIPS
By David Monti, @d9monti
(c) 2021 Race Results Weekly, all rights reserved, used with permission.
A total of 59 student-athletes (39 women and 20 men) who competed in the NCAA Division I Indoor Championships in Fayetteville, Ark., from March 11 – 13, are scheduled to also compete in tomorrow’s NCAA Division I Cross Country Championships in Stillwater, Oklahoma. Stillwater is about a three-hour drive due west of Fayetteville.

The University of Arkansas has the most doublers: eight women and four men. NC State has five women, but no men.

Among the podium finishers in Fayetteville, the following athletes are entered for Stillwater. Only one event winner, Wesley Kiptoo of Iowa State who won the 5000m, is doubling:

WOMEN –
Krissy Gear, Arkansas (2nd, mile; 2nd, DMR)
Kennedy Thomson, Arkansas (3rd, mile)
Lauren Gregory, Arkansas (2nd, 3000m; 2nd, DMR)
Quinn Owen, Arkansas (2nd, DMR)
Alyson Churchill, Florida State (3rd, DMR)
Maudie Skyring, Florida State (3rd, DMR)
Bethany Hasz, Minnesota (2nd, 5000m)

MEN –
Wesley Kiptoo, Iowa State (1st, 5000m)
Waleed Suliman, Ole Miss (3rd, Mile)
Mario Garcia Romo, Ole Miss (3rd, 3000m; 2nd, DMR)
Morgan Beadlescomb, Michigan State (3rd, 5000m)

Not all of the 59 will start tomorrow in Stillwater; scratches are inevitable.
